Not even remotely close
Jun 12, 2018, 1:44 PM
[ in reply to Johnson = Belk ] |
|
Belk didn't have family reasons, he had "family reasons." He was also going to get plenty of playing time here at in 2019 once Wilkins, Lawrence, and Huggins leave. He's now sitting out 2018 at SCAR to play there in 2019 so it's not like he's fast tracking his career. He basically just quit on Clemson and went to our biggest rival.
It's very clear why Hunter Johnson is leaving and i don't fault him for it one bit. Only 1 QB can play at a time and he didn't think he was going to get to play at Clemson. He was a 5-star recruit with aspirations of playing in the NFL and it's far more likely that he achieves that by starting for NW than backing up Bryant and ultimately Lawrence at Clemson.
Simply put, Belk would've had his sophomore season and beyond to compete for the starting job at Clemson and if he was as good as his ranking out of HS he would've done so. Hunter Johnson was stuck behind what most see as a generational QB talent at Clemson and there's a good chance he never would've started.
